Abe Orthopedics
Abe Orthopedics is a specialized orthopedic clinic in Tokyo treating musculoskeletal conditions, including joint, bone, and soft tissue injuries. The facility operates with a two-consultation system where patients can choose between the director (who is highly sought after) or substitute doctors including a female physician. Wait times can be substantial—patients should allocate up to two hours for visits due to the clinic’s popularity. The medical care is thorough and detailed, with doctors taking time to provide comprehensive explanations of conditions and treatment plans. The clinic has received positive feedback for its efficiency and knowledgeable staff. At least one doctor provides clear explanations in English for non-Japanese speakers. Patients particularly praise the director’s expertise, though this means longer waits for those who specifically request consultations with him. The overall patient experience is characterized by thorough care despite the wait times.
